Homeless Support Worker Assistant Part Time 24.5 hrs Wokingham £24,627 starting, progressing to £25,070 Enhanced DBS Required Reference: TWO1209198 Drivers Licence: Not Required Lone Working: No Night Working: No Weekend Working: Yes At Two Saints, we are proud of our values and our mission: to provide people with homes and specialist support so they feel valued and secure, and ready to take their next steps. We're seeking compassionate, adaptable people to join our Wokingham service as a Homeless Support Worker Assistant. You'll bring a passion for supporting people to build confidence, develop essential life skills, and recognise their own strengths and support needs through positive, meaningful interactions. As the ideal candidate, your ability to connect with people will help them build trust, resilience, and a sense of possibility for their future. You will learn knowledge of safeguarding, working proactively within our policies, and contribute to a strong, collaborative team environment. Our Homeless Support Worker Assistant roles are support-based, focused on guidance, encouragement, and empowering clients to achieve their goals. The work can be challenging, but also truly rewarding - made even more so by the supportive, values-driven team who will help nurture and develop your skills. Homeless Support Worker Assistant Essentials: * An interest and concern for homelessness and related issues * Ability to contribute to a team * Good communication skills, clear verbal and written English * Knowledge of Microsoft Outlook, Excel and Word Homeless Support Worker Assistant Desirables: * Experience in similar sectors * Experience in customer service roles Could this be you? About Us

We offer support to people who are homeless, vulnerable or at risk of becoming homeless and need help rebuilding their lives for a brighter future. Our services include safe, flexible and reliable client led housing and support with a focus on reducing homelessness, improving health and wellbeing and building on individual's skills and resilience to break the cycle of homelessness, poverty and exclusion.

We work in partnership with multiple agencies and authorities to deliver support and accommodation needs across Berkshire, Hampshire, Isle of Wight and Dorset.
